Why Traditional Solutions Don't Work for Vets
Hiring More Reception Staff
The obvious answer — hire another receptionist — faces real obstacles in Россия's current labour market. Veterinary reception requires specialized knowledge: breed names, medication enquiries, triage of emergency calls, insurance processes, and emotional intelligence when dealing with distressed pet owners. Training takes 4-8 weeks, turnover is high (the role is stressful and often underpaid), and the VoiceFleet pricing of a full-time receptionist including benefits and taxes often exceeds ₽2,500/month.
Answering Services
Generic answering services take messages but can't triage emergencies, book appointments, or answer specific questions about your practice. Pet owners calling about a potentially poisoned dog don't want to leave a message — they need immediate guidance.

After-Hours: The Hidden Revenue Opportunity
Most veterinary practices in Россия close by 7-8 PM. But pet emergencies don't follow office hours. A puppy eating chocolate at 10 PM. A cat with a blocked bladder at 2 AM. An elderly dog struggling to breathe at 5 AM on a Sunday.
Currently, these callers hear voicemail and either panic or call an emergency vet — often paying 3-5x your normal rates. With VoiceFleet:
